Web19 mei 2024 · The lowpass filter is a filter that allows the signal with the frequency is lower than the cutoff frequency and attenuates the signals with the frequency is more than cutoff frequency. In the first-order filter, the number of reactive components is only one. The below figure shows the circuit diagram of the first-order lowpass Butterworth filter. Web12 nov. 2024 · One fundamental filter that can be constructed from simple passive circuit elements is a bandpass filter. The graph for a bandpass filter Bode plot can transition to low-pass behavior if the system’s resistance is large enough, and this is one aspect of the filter that can be seen visually.

On the other hand, a high-pass (or low-cut) filter will remove frequencies below a given threshold. For many producers, this has become a go-to step to give clarity to the mix. Low-cutting most elements except your kick and sub-bass between 60 Hz and 120 Hz will help tighten up the low-end. genesis baptist church buna tx
